I find that up until TATH all the albums have distinct musical properties:
The EP is punk-influenced rock'n'rolll
Up To Here is folky, acoustic
Road Apples is a real southern blues rocker
Fully Completely is driving American radio rock, as you said, in the grunge vein
Day For Night is deep, dark, introspective and angry
Then TATH comes along and I can't attach a tag to it. But I think Phantom Power is the best "mature" rock record out there by any band. There's something about it that's fresh and original but also something that gives the impression that the artists have been around for a long time. However, after Phantom Power, M@W and IVL don't seem to fit into categories either.
